Girl, 3, sits with Santa Claus so he doesn't have to eat alone

A three-year-old girl in the US has cemented her place on Santa's nice list after befriending a Saint Nick who she would not let eat alone.

Gracie Lynn Wilson was having breakfast with her parents at a Bob Evans restaurant in Evansville, Indiana, when she spotted "Santa Cwaus", as she called him, dining in a nearby booth on Thursday.

With mum's permission, Gracie Lynn pulled up a chair and started chatting with the man, dressed in red overalls, with a long silver beard and curly silver hair.

A touching photos of the youngster keeping the lonely Santa-lookalike company has been seen by tens of thousands of people, with many touched by Gracie Lynn's generous act.

"They just started having a conversation like they'd known each other for years," mum Lindsey Wilson told WFIE.

When asked what she wanted for Christmas, Gracie didn't want any presents.

She told Santa all she wants is to meet her unborn baby brother James, who is due in three weeks.

Speaking to WFIE at a local shopping mall photo booth, Santa said he thinks Gracie is pretty special and that her Christmas wish might just come true.
